
Baghdad - INA
The three presidencies held Sunday evening, a meeting with political leaders to discuss the creation of a unified internal front to confront the escalation between Washington and Tehran.
All the main political leaders have responded to President Barham Salih's call for a meeting to discuss the seriousness of the situation and the tension that the region is experiencing as a result of the recent escalation between the United States and Iran, spokesman Luqman al-Faily said.
Al Faily also said that the meeting discussed ways to work reduce tension through the unification of the national discourse and positions in coordination between presidencies and the political block and the house of Representatives
He added that the President of the Republic presented during the meeting a working paper was agreed upon, noting that "the national consensus reflected the importance of communication between political leaders and neighboring countries to come up with a position that rises to the level of existing challenges away from the media.
